Brian Lee

CEO/Registrar

Brian Lee is Chief Executive of the Health Insurance Authority, having joined the organisation in June 2024.

Prior to this, he spent over three years with the HSE as Head of Operations for the Test and Trace Programme. He previously served as National Director of Quality Assurance at Tusla – the Child and Family Agency for over six years.

Brian has also held senior roles as Director of Operations with Health Care Informed, National Clinical Care Programme Manager in the HSE, and as a Project Manager and Inspector with HIQA. He began his substantive career with United Drug.

He has served as Chair of the Board of Gheel Autism Services and as a member of the CORU Council, the statutory regulator for health and social care professionals.

Brian holds an MBA from TU Dublin and a number of qualifications from University College Dublin, including a degree in Biochemistry and postgraduate diplomas in Healthcare Risk Management and Quality, Professional Regulation, and Organisational Renewal and Transformation.

Síle Hanley

Head of Regulation and Compliance

Síle Hanley is a senior actuary with experience across insurance regulation. Síle was previously at the Central Bank of Ireland where she held roles in both life and non-life insurance, most recently leading the actuarial support for the supervision of health insurers and insurers in other market segments. Prior to joining the Central Bank, she worked in life insurance outsourcing. 

She holds a degree in Mathematical Sciences from University College Cork and a HDip in Actuarial Science from University College Dublin.

Christina Prendergast

Head of Communications and Stakeholder Engagement

Christina Prendergast has worked in communications in a number of roles across the public and private sector, including most recently as Head of Communications in the Department of Further and Higher Education, Research, Innovation and Science.

She holds diplomas in digital marketing, sales and marketing and event management, a LLB, and completed her MBA in 2018.

Michael McNaughton

Head of Operations

Michael is a qualified accountant with experience across a range of industries. Prior to joining the Health Insurance Authority, Michael was Head of Finance at Coillte, Ireland's state forestry agency, where he worked on state net zero targets. He previously held roles in financial regulation in the NHS and in professional services in Dublin. 

Michael holds a degree in History and Politics from Trinity College and a Postgrad in Accountancy from Technological University Dublin. Most recently, he has undertaken an MBA at UCD Smurfit School.

Cormac Delaney

Head of Risk Equalisation

Cormac Delaney is a Chartered Accountant with experience across a wide variety of roles in the public and private sector, including the Office of the Comptroller and Auditor General and professional accountancy practices in the Dublin area.

He is a Fellow of Chartered Accountants Ireland and holds a Diploma in Business Innovation from Dublin City University.
